ST Math Initiative Boosts Math Proficiency
Recent findings from the Annenberg Institute at Brown University have unveiled a compelling advantage for students in Massachusetts utilizing the ST Math program, administered by the One8 Foundation. With the aim of enriching math education, this initiative has demonstrated substantial improvements in student achievement, showcasing the power of effective implementation and consistent curriculum engagement.
Overview of the Study
Released in January 2026, the independent study spotlights that students participating in schools supported by the One8 Foundation experienced remarkably higher math learning gains than their counterparts. Specifically, the ST Math program, which is known for its visual approach to teaching mathematics, has effectively accelerated the math proficiency of over 140,000 students statewide.
About one-third of elementary students in Massachusetts now engage with ST Math, with a notable 79% of those in programs backed by the One8 Foundation. The study's findings reveal that students in One8-supported schools made learning gains equating to an additional two weeks of instruction as compared to peers, measured against the Massachusetts Comprehensive Assessment System (MCAS) math assessments. What’s more, in classrooms where students completed a commendable 80% of the ST Math curriculum, the learning gains spiked to more than a month’s worth of additional learning.
Closing the Implementation Gap
A critical aspect of the One8 initiative is the systematic support provided, which narrows the implementation gap often seen in educational programs. Schools receiving One8 grants benefit from comprehensive teacher training, tailored community engagement, and dedicated support managers who facilitate effective ST Math usage—yielding impressive outcomes. In these schools, 52% of students achieved at least 80% of curriculum completion, compared to a mere 3% in non-supported institutions.

Key Highlights from the Findings
- - Equity in Learning: The study highlighted that ST Math is particularly effective among economically disadvantaged students and English learners, ensuring equitable math education across demographics.
- - Enhanced Engagement: Students in One8-supported environments spent over 40 hours per year navigating the challenging games of ST Math, contrasting sharply with only six hours logged by peers in non-supported schools. This immersion appears to correlate directly with improved learning outcomes.
- - Statistically Significant Gains: Students completing 80% or more of the ST Math curriculum demonstrated noticeable gains in their learning, showcasing evidence that consistent engagement translates into academic progress.
- - Support Translates to Success: The comprehensive resources available to One8 grant recipients—including in-person training and Education Success Managers—result in a superior support system for teachers, allowing them to receive individual attention and guidance, which facilitates the effective implementation of ST Math.

Looking Ahead
The study conducted by Brown University is part of a five-year initiative aimed at observing long-term student progress and the effects of the One8 Foundation’s support mechanisms.
